Travel Tips: Staying on Time at LAX

To make your travel experience at LAX smooth and stress-free, here are a few travel tips related to time:

  1. Check the Time Regularly: Always check the current local time at LAX before heading to the airport. You can find this information on various websites, apps, and airport displays.
  2. Factor in Time Differences: If you're traveling from another time zone, make sure you factor in the time difference. Adjust your watch or phone to the local time at LAX as soon as you arrive.
  3. Plan for Delays: Always plan for potential delays, especially during peak travel times. Arrive at the airport well in advance of your flight to allow for check-in, security checks, and any unexpected issues.
  4. Use Reliable Time Sources: Use official sources like the airport’s website, reliable weather apps, or the airport’s information displays to check the time.
  5. Set Alerts: Set reminders and alerts on your phone or travel apps for your flight times, gate changes, and other important information. This is super helpful!
